Il suffit simplement de se rappeler de l\u2019abr\u00e9viation <strong>VGA<\/strong> qui signifie :<\/p>\n<p><strong>V = Volt pour la tension \u00e9lectrique<\/strong>, le transpondeur a besoin d\u2019une alimentation d&rsquo;environ 12v CC<\/p>\n<p><strong>G = GPS<\/strong>, le GPS du transpondeur doit bien recevoir la position<\/p>\n<p><strong>A = Antenne<\/strong>, l\u2019antenne AIS\/VHF doit \u00eatre de bonne condition et bien connect\u00e9e au transpondeur.<span class=\"Apple-converted-space\">\u00a0<\/span><\/p>\n<p>&nbsp;<\/p>\n<h4 style=\"text-align: center;\"><strong>V\u00e9rification de la tension \u00e9lectrique<\/strong><\/h4>\n<p>La tension \u00e9lectrique peut \u00eatre v\u00e9rifi\u00e9e en utilisant un multim\u00e8tre (r\u00e9gler pour mesurer courant continu) sur le fil rouge et noir du transpondeur ou plus simplement en utilisant le logiciel proAIS2. Avec le logiciel, il faut aller dans l\u2019onglet diagnostique et voir la valeur affich\u00e9e en milieu de page (voir image ci-dessus).<span class=\"Apple-converted-space\">\u00a0Le transpondeur a besoin d\u2019une alimentation d&rsquo;environ 12v CC<\/span><\/p>\n<p>&nbsp;<\/p>\n<h4 style=\"text-align: center;\"><strong>V\u00e9rification de la r\u00e9ception GPS<\/strong><\/h4>\n<p>La r\u00e9ception GPS peut aussi \u00eatre v\u00e9rifi\u00e9e en utilisant proAIS2 puis en allant dans l\u2019onglet GNSS Statut. Bien que vous receviez sur votre radio VHF ou syst\u00e8me AIS, votre transmission AIS sera surement faible due \u00e0 une antenne VHF d\u00e9grad\u00e9e ou vieillissante. Le mauvais \u00e9tat d\u2019une antenne VHF se v\u00e9rifie si le taux d\u2019Onde stationnaire est tr\u00e8s haut (VSWR).<span class=\"Apple-converted-space\">\u00a0 <\/span>Le VSWR d\u2019un transpondeur AIS se mesure avec le niveau d\u2019ondes stationnaires pr\u00e9sents dans le c\u00e2ble de l\u2019antenne. Les ondes stationnaires sont les signaux qui ne se r\u00e9pandent pas dans l\u2019air et l\u2019antenne mais directement dans le c\u00e2ble jusqu\u2019\u00e0 sa source (le transpondeur AIS).<span class=\"Apple-converted-space\">\u00a0<\/span><\/p>\n<p>Dans un monde id\u00e9al, tous les signaux envoy\u00e9s \u00e0 l\u2019antenne seraient transmis aux autres navires \u00e0 travers l\u2019air, mais ceci est seulement possible si l\u2019imp\u00e9dance de la source, de l\u2019antenne et du c\u00e2ble sont identiques (50 ohms).<span class=\"Apple-converted-space\">\u00a0<\/span><\/p>\n<p><img  loading=\"lazy\"  decoding=\"async\"  class=\"aligncenter wp-image-2948 pk-lazyload\"  src=\"data:image\/png;base64,iVBORw0KGgoAAAANSUhEUgAAAAEAAAABAQMAAAAl21bKAAAAA1BMVEUAAP+KeNJXAAAAAXRSTlMAQObYZgAAAAlwSFlzAAAOxAAADsQBlSsOGwAAAApJREFUCNdjYAAAAAIAAeIhvDMAAAAASUVORK5CYII=\"  alt=\"Explication du du taux d\u2019Onde stationnaire \"  width=\"647\"  height=\"447\"  data-pk-sizes=\"auto\"  data-ls-sizes=\"auto, (max-width: 647px) 100vw, 647px\"  data-pk-src=\"https:\/\/digitalyacht.fr\/blog\/wp-content\/uploads\/2018\/08\/VSWR-Explained-2-1024x707.png\"  data-pk-srcset=\"https:\/\/digitalyacht.fr\/blog\/wp-content\/uploads\/2018\/08\/VSWR-Explained-2-1024x707.png 1024w, https:\/\/digitalyacht.fr\/blog\/wp-content\/uploads\/2018\/08\/VSWR-Explained-2-300x207.png 300w, https:\/\/digitalyacht.fr\/blog\/wp-content\/uploads\/2018\/08\/VSWR-Explained-2-768x530.png 768w, https:\/\/digitalyacht.fr\/blog\/wp-content\/uploads\/2018\/08\/VSWR-Explained-2-211x146.png 211w, https:\/\/digitalyacht.fr\/blog\/wp-content\/uploads\/2018\/08\/VSWR-Explained-2-50x35.png 50w, https:\/\/digitalyacht.fr\/blog\/wp-content\/uploads\/2018\/08\/VSWR-Explained-2-109x75.png 109w, https:\/\/digitalyacht.fr\/blog\/wp-content\/uploads\/2018\/08\/VSWR-Explained-2.png 1060w\" ><\/p>\n<p>&nbsp;<\/p>\n<h4 style=\"text-align: center;\"><strong>Le taux d\u2019onde stationnaire (VSWR)<\/strong><\/h4>\n<p>Si les imp\u00e9dances \u00e9taient parfaites alors le taux d\u2019onde stationnaire (VSWR) serait de 1:1. Cependant, dans le monde r\u00e9el, le taux le plus probable d\u2019\u00eatre obtenu est entre 1.1:1 et 2.5:1.<span class=\"Apple-converted-space\">\u00a0<\/span><\/p>\n<p>Dans l\u2019onglet diagnostique de proAIS2, le taux d\u2019onde stationnaire (VSWR) est affich\u00e9 et est mis \u00e0 jour \u00e0 chaque fois que le transpondeur AIS transmet. Lorsque le transpondeur AIS transmet alors vous verrez un petit changement dans les d\u00e9cimales du taux d\u2019onde stationnaire et ceci est normal.
